Medical Records Specialist Salary in Kentucky (2026)
$23.28 per hour · take-home ≈ $39,383/year ($3,282/month) for a single filer
Kentucky ranks 39th of 51 states for Medical Records Specialist pay, with a median about 8% below the national average. Of the 4,210 Medical Records Specialist jobs BLS counts in Kentucky, the typical worker earns $48,410 a year — though pay ranges from $36,290 for newcomers to $74,520 at the top.
Medical Records Specialist pay range in Kentucky
| Percentile | Annual wage | Meaning |
| 10th percentile (entry) | $36,290 | Lowest-paid 10% earn less than this |
| 25th percentile | $40,570 | A quarter earn less |
| Median (50th) | $48,410 | Half earn more, half earn less |
| 75th percentile | $61,720 | Top quarter starts here |
| 90th percentile (top) | $74,520 | Highest-paid 10% earn more than this |
BLS reports 4,210 Medical Records Specialist jobs in Kentucky (occupation code 29-2072, “Medical Records Specialists”).
Gross vs. take-home in Kentucky
A median Medical Records Specialist salary of $48,410 doesn’t all reach your bank account. After federal income tax, Social Security, and Medicare, plus Kentucky state income tax, a single filer keeps about $39,383 — an effective tax rate of 18.6%.
| Gross (median) | $48,410 |
| Federal income tax | −$3,629 |
| Social Security + Medicare | −$3,703 |
| Kentucky state income tax | −$1,694 |
| Take-home (annual) | $39,383 |
| Take-home (monthly) | $3,282 |

Sources and methodology
Wage and employment figures: BLS OEWS May 2025 (state file, released April 2026) — the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ics survey, the most authoritative public salary dataset. Take-home estimate: 2026 federal brackets, FICA, and verified Kentucky state tax rules (single filer, standard deduction, no credits or local taxes). Estimates only — not financial advice.
